Earnings for General Biology Graduates from Florida State College at Jacksonville

Graduates of Florida State College at Jacksonville’s General Biology program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for General Biology at Florida State College at Jacksonville
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$26,793
2 years $21,052
3 years $30,774
4 years $44,884
5 years $47,847

How does this compare to the school overall? Four years out, General Biology graduates from Florida State College at Jacksonville take home a median $44,884, compared with $43,343 for all Florida State College at Jacksonville graduates — about 4% higher than the school-wide median.

General Biology Bachelor’s Program at Florida State College at Jacksonville

Among the 16 bachelor’s general biology degrees awarded at Florida State College at Jacksonville, 75% were women (12) and 25% were men (4).

Florida State College at Jacksonville gender breakdown of General Biology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of General Biology bachelor’s degree recipients at Florida State College at Jacksonville.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 8
Hispanic / Latino 2
Black / African American 2
Asian 1
Two or More Races 2
International (Nonresident) 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of General Biology majors at Florida State College at Jacksonville

Minority students account for 44% of General Biology bachelor’s degree recipients at Florida State College at Jacksonville, lower than the national average of 47%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
